[S390] cio: Restart path verification after unsolicited interrupt.
If we try to start path verification when an unsolicited interrupt is already pending, stctl shows status pending and we delay path verification again. We need to check for the doverify bit when the unsolicited interrupt comes in and then do path verification. Signed-off-by: Cornelia Huck <cornelia.huck@de.ibm.com> Signed-off-by: Martin Schwidefsky <schwidefsky@de.ibm.com>
This commit is contained in:
Родитель
b075083f35
Коммит
18374d376c
|
@ -842,6 +842,8 @@ ccw_device_irq(struct ccw_device *cdev, enum dev_event dev_event)
|
|||
call_handler_unsol:
|
||||
if (cdev->handler)
|
||||
cdev->handler (cdev, 0, irb);
|
||||
if (cdev->private->flags.doverify)
|
||||
ccw_device_online_verify(cdev, 0);
|
||||
return;
|
||||
}
|
||||
/* Accumulate status and find out if a basic sense is needed. */
|
||||
|
|
Загрузка…
Ссылка в новой задаче